Leadership Roles at Naftogaz
Oleksandr Chuprina - Chief Executive Officer
Oleksandr Chuprina, the Chief Executive Officer at Naftogaz, directs the company's overarching strategy and operational execution. Chuprina oversees the full cycle of oil and gas operations, from exploration and production to transport and storage, ensuring the efficient delivery of natural gas and LPG across Europe, Asia, and the Middle East. Baker Hughes is a global energy technology company that provides advanced solutions to the oil and gas industry, as well as other energy sectors. Headquartered in Houston, Texas, the company is known for offering a wide range of services and products that support the exploration, production, and transportation of oil and natural gas. Baker Hughes operates in various segments, including oilfield services, digital solutions, and turbomachinery and process solutions.

Suncor Energy Inc. is a Canadian integrated energy company headquartered in Calgary, Alberta, that focuses on developing, producing and supplying energy from a diverse mix of sources including oil sands, conventional oil and gas, petroleum refining, and lowercarbon fuels and power. The companys operations span the extraction and upgrading of bitumen from oil sands, offshore and onshore exploration and production, and the refining and marketing of petroleum products, supported by a national retail and wholesale distribution network. Alongside traditional energy activities, Suncor invests in projects aimed at lowercarbon intensity fuels and power, and participates in supply and trading of crude, natural gas and related products, with a strategic emphasis on operational excellence and contributing to broader energy transitions.

Petroleum Development Oman, founded in 1937 and headquartered in Muscat, Sultanate of Oman, Company delivers the majority of the country's crude oil production and natural gas supply. The Company is owned by the Government of Oman, Royal Dutch Shell, Total, and Partex.

Seplat Petroleum was founded in 2009 and is headquartered in Lagos, Nigeria, an indigenous Nigerian oil and gas exploration and production company with a strategic focus on Nigeria.
